Passy is a town in the Foundiougne department of the Fatick region , in the south-west of Senegal .

Geographical location

Passy is located in the northeast of the Foundiougne department halfway between the towns of Kaolack in the northeast and Sokone in the southwest.

Passy is located 151 kilometers southeast of Dakar , 42 kilometers south of the Fatick regional prefecture and 28 kilometers southeast of Foundiougne .

population

According to the last census, the city's population has developed as follows:

year Residents
1988 3,953
2002 6,177
2013 12,571

traffic

Passy lies on the national highway N 5 , the Kaolack through the hinterland of Saloumdeltas with Banjul , the capital of the neighboring country Gambia connects. The N5 is also part of the Dakar-Lagos Highway , one of the Trans-African Highways . In the city center, the asphalted R61 branches off the N5 in a north-westerly direction, creating the only regional land connection to the departmental prefecture of Foundiougne .

Passy is connected to Kaolack Airport, 28 km away, and the national air transport network via the N5 .
